Saturday, 26 February 2022 10:58
By REUTERS
An earthquake of magnitude 6 struck Mindanao, Philippines on Saturday, the European Mediterranean Seismological Centre (EMSC) said.
The quake was at a depth of 121 km (75.19 miles), EMSC said.
